Daniel R. Davis earned the Bachelor of Music Education and Masters degrees in Saxophone Performance and Woodwind Pedagogy while at Ohio University, where he served as a graduate assistant of bands for four years. He also holds a Doctor of Musical Arts in Conducting from the College/Conservatory of Music at the University of Cincinnati.
Dr. Davis’ twenty years teaching experience includes High and Middle School in Ohio, Frostburg State University in Maryland, and Cypress Lake Center for the Arts, South Dade High School in Miami, and Estero High School. Dr. Davis is currently in his fifth year as Director of Bands at Caloosa Middle School in Cape Coral.
Davis has been a member of the Southwest Florida Symphony Chorus for eight years and frequently plays saxophone with the Southwest Florida Symphony Orchestra.
